AB, CD and PQ are three lines concurrent at O. If angle AOP =5y, angle QOD =2y and angle BOC=5y ,find the value of y

Answer:
y=15°
Step-by-step explanation:
angle AOP = angle BOQ(alternate angles)
angle AOP=5y
therefore, angle BOQ = 5y
angle BOC = angle AOD (alternate angles)
angle BOC = 5y
therefore, angle AOD = 5y
angle QOD = angle POC (alternate angles)
angle QOD = 2y
therefore, angle POC = 2y
sum of all the angles = 360°
therefore, angle AOP + angle POC + angle BOC + angle BOQ + angle QOD + angle DOA = 360°
5y + 2y + 5y + 5y + 2y + 5y = 360°
24y = 360°
y = 360°/ 24 = 15°
